{"id":140633,"date":"2026-07-27T12:42:31","date_gmt":"2026-07-27T16:42:31","guid":{"rendered":"https:\/\/cablemanpro.com\/wallstreetpr\/debt-ridden-democrats-tap-a-surprising-asset-as-collateral-for-15m-loan-140633"},"modified":"2026-07-27T12:42:31","modified_gmt":"2026-07-27T16:42:31","slug":"debt-ridden-democrats-tap-a-surprising-asset-as-collateral-for-15m-loan","status":"publish","type":"post","link":"https:\/\/cablemanpro.com\/wallstreetpr\/debt-ridden-democrats-tap-a-surprising-asset-as-collateral-for-15m-loan-140633","title":{"rendered":"Debt-ridden Democrats tap a surprising asset as collateral for $15M loan"},"content":{"rendered":"<div>\n<p>As the Democratic National Committee (DNC) shouldered significant debt and fell behind its GOP equivalent, Democratic leadership decided to use its headquarters as collateral for a $15 million loan, according to public records.<\/p>\n<p>The loan, first reported by NOTUS news outlet, was taken out in 2025 as the DNC struggled to keep pace with the Republican National Committee\u2019s fundraising efforts ahead of the <a href=\"https:\/\/foxnews.com\/category\/politics\/elections\/midterm-elections\" rel=\"noopener noreferrer\" target=\"_blank\">midterm elections<\/a>.<\/p>\n<p>While taking out loans ahead of high-stakes races is common, and using property as collateral to do so is <span class=\"suggestion-underline suggestion-copy-editor\">no<\/span>t unheard of, the line of credit secured by the DNC was the largest ever taken out by the committee for an off-year election, according to NOTUS. The terms of the loan allow the DNC to withdraw an additional $5 million beyond the $15 million it already has taken, public records <a href=\"https:\/\/docquery.fec.gov\/pdf\/270\/202511209792904270\/202511209792904270.pdf\" rel=\"noopener noreferrer nofollow\" target=\"_blank\">show<\/a>.<\/p>\n<p>&#8220;This is not new,<span class=\"suggestion-underline suggestion-copy-editor\">&#8220;<\/span> a DNC official told Fox News Digital Monday of the loan. &#8220;The loan documents were publicly released in November, and the DNC\u2019s building was also used as collateral in our prior lines of credit in 2019, 2018, 2014 and many other years.&#8221;<\/p>\n<p><a href=\"https:\/\/foxnews.com\/media\/cash-strapped-dnc-shelled-out-more-than-800k-non-voting-territories-like-virgin-islands-while-debt\" rel=\"noopener noreferrer\" target=\"_blank\"><strong>CASH-STRAPPED DNC SHELLED OUT MORE THAN $800K TO NON-VOTING TERRITORIES LIKE VIRGIN ISLANDS WHILE IN DEBT<\/strong><\/a><\/p>\n<p>What is new, however, is the DNC\u2019s considerable debt.<\/p>\n<p>The financial gap between Democrats and Republicans, as well as the former&#8217;s higher-than-usual debt load, could leave the DNC with less flexibility to support candidates in the midterm elections. The national party\u2019s debt and smaller cash reserves could limit its ability to respond quickly, invest broadly and compete with the GOP\u2019s far larger war chest, a boon to conservatives who are currently struggling in the polls.<\/p>\n<p>As of June 30, the DNC has $18.5 million in debt against just $16.3 million in cash on hand, <a href=\"https:\/\/www.fec.gov\/data\/committee\/C00010603\/\" rel=\"noopener noreferrer nofollow\" target=\"_blank\">according<\/a> to campaign finance records. For comparison, the DNC ended 2022, the previous <a href=\"https:\/\/foxnews.com\/category\/politics\/elections\" rel=\"noopener noreferrer\" target=\"_blank\">midterm cycle<\/a>, with <a href=\"https:\/\/www.fec.gov\/data\/committee\/C00010603\/?cycle=2022\" rel=\"noopener noreferrer nofollow\" target=\"_blank\">$30.5 million<\/a> in cash against roughly $420,000 in debt.<\/p>\n<p>The Republican National Committee, by comparison, had $128.5 million in cash with no debt as of June 30, <a href=\"https:\/\/www.fec.gov\/data\/committee\/C00003418\/\" rel=\"noopener noreferrer nofollow\" target=\"_blank\">per<\/a> Federal Election Commission records.<\/p>\n<p>That the DNC is using its headquarters as collateral for a loan isn&#8217;t necessarily a sign that the organization is in its death throes.
